Subgroup analysis showed that fibrinolytic therapy reduced 35-day mortality among patients with ST elevation in the anterior leads or “other” leads but failed to reach statistical significance among patients with ST elevation in the inferior leads (11% proportional reduction; 95% CI − 24% to + 5%; p = 0.08) [ 13 ].
